+2.26
475 читачів, 28983 публікації

Установка Zabbix Agent на VCSA 6.5

Не так давно VMware випустила VCSA 6.5, яку рекомендувала до використання, замість традиційної інсталяції vCenter на платформу Windows. Відповідно у деяких міг з'явитися питання, а як моніторити VCSA?

Інфа під катом: Як зібрати і встановити Zabbix Agent на VCSA + Трохи інформації про пристрій VCSA.

Читати далі →

6 нестандартних прийомів для поліпшення продуктивності і безпеки сайту

Швидкість і безпека – основні критерії успіху електронного бізнесу. Коли на завантаження сайту йде більше 3 секунд, ви втрачаєте потенційного доходу і втрачаєте позиції в рейтингах пошукових систем. А коли сайт недостатньо захищений, у зломщиків відкривається можливість нанести удар по вашій репутації і прибутку.

Коли мова заходить про оптимізацію продуктивності, найчастіше згадується використання стиснення, мінімізація розміру файлів, кешування, використання полегшеного коду тим, шаблонів, модулів розширень і т. д.

Якщо говорити про безпеку, то з нею в першу чергу асоціюються відповідні розширення, використання файрвола для веб-додатків, оновлення застарілих компонентів.

Всі ці методи цілком прийнятні, але разом з ними можна використовувати і наступні.

Наведені нижче підходить для будь-якої платформи, в тому числі WordPress, Joomla, Magento, Drupal, Node.js і пр. Подивимося, з якими підходами ви вже знайомі, а з якими — ні.



Читати далі →

Аутентифікація користувачів термінальних серверів на FirePOWER



Для нас, інженерів, стежити за появою нових версій FirePOWER – справжнє задоволення. Кожен раз, відкриваючи черговий Release Notes, ми із завмиранням серця (а іноді і з повною зупинкою) вивчаємо нові фічі, додані розробниками.

Одним з очікуваних нововведень став Cisco Terminal Server Agent (далі TS Agent). Він призначений для коректної аутентифікації користувачів термінальних серверів (далі ТЗ). В даному матеріалі розповім, навіщо він потрібен і як працює.
Читати далі →

HyperFlex — дві нові all-flash-системи від Cisco

HyperFlex — це інтегроване гиперконвергентное інфраструктурне рішення, в основі якого лежить програмне забезпечення Springpath HALO, сервери Cisco UCS і мережеві компоненти Nexus. Раніше в лінійці HyperFlex були представлены лише гібридні і дискові пристрої. Але минулого тижня компанія Cisco анонсувала дві all-flash-системи.


Читати далі →

Установка MLDonkey і DC++ плагіна для нього

Поставив я собі недавно завдання — створити в локальній мережі бота, який був би встановлений на самому серверному комп'ютері, і управлявся б, в ідеалі, через web-інтерфейс, але можна і по SSH. Завдання бота — цілодобово сидіти на роздачі. При спробі знайти такий DC++ клієнт, я з прикрістю виявив, що продуктів відповідали моїм вимогам поки немає. Ncdc і MicroDC2 так і не вдалося запустити як демон, так і працювали вони зі скрипом. У бік MLDonkey не дивився т. к. розглядав його швидше як альтернативу торрент-клієнт Transmission, ніж як клієнт мереж DC++. А даремно!
Читати далі →

Керування світильниками по протоколу DALI з допомогою Arduino

протоколі DALI
DALI (Digital Addressable Lighting Interface) – протокол, призначений для керування освітлювальними приладами. Протокол був розроблений австрійською компанією Tridonic і заснований на манчестерському кодуванні: кожен біт даних кодується перепадом від сигналу низького до високого або навпаки.

Читати далі →

Розподілений xargs, або Виконання гетерогенних додатків на Hadoop-кластері

enter image description here
Привіт, Хабр!
Мене звати Олександр Крашенинников, я керую DataTeam в Badoo. Сьогодні я поділюся з вами простий і елегантною утилітою для розподіленого виконання команд в стилі xargs, а заодно розповім історію її виникнення.
Наш відділ BI працює з обсягами даних, для обробки яких потрібні ресурси більш ніж однієї машини. У наших процесах ETL (Extract Transform Load) в хід йдуть звичні світу Big Data розподілені системи Hadoop і Spark в зв'язці з OLAP-базою Exasol. Використання цих інструментів дозволяє нам горизонтально масштабуватися як по дисковому простору, так і за CPU/ RAM.
Безумовно, в наших процесах ETL існують не тільки великі завдання на кластері, але і машинерія простіше. Широкий пласт завдань вирішується поодинокими PHP/ Python-скриптами без залучення гб оперативної пам'яті і дюжини жорстких дисків. Але в один прекрасний день нам треба було адаптувати одну CPU-bound завдання для виконання в 250 паралельних инстансов. Настала пора маленькому Python-скрипту покинути межі рідного хоста і полинути у великий кластер!
Читати далі →

Як працюють ІТ-фахівці. Андрій Макаров, компанія Neti

Ми продовжуємо розпитувати фахівців про режим праці та відпочинку, професійні звички, про інструментарій, який вони використовують, і багато чому іншому.

Буде цікаво з'ясувати, що їх об'єднує, в чому вони суперечать один одному. Можливо, їх відповіді допоможуть виявити якісь загальні закономірності, корисні поради, які допоможуть багатьом з нас.

Сьогодні наш гість — Андрій Макаров з Neti. Він працює у сфері інформаційних технологій вже 14 років. Працюючи в компанії з 2011 року, Андрій пройшов від тимлида до директора департаменту. Збільшив чистий прибуток департаменту 1С в 10 разів. З 2015 року запускає нові напрямки в компанії. Андрій постійно навчається менеджменту, психології, маркетингу, продажу і новим трендам в ІТ.
Читати далі →

Виключення Windows x64. Як це працює. Частина 1

Раніше ми обговорювали прикладне застосування механізму обробки виключень поза середовища Windows. Тепер ми більш детально розглянемо, як це працює в Windows x64. Матеріал буде описаний послідовно, починаючи з самих основ. Тому багато чого може виявитися вам знайомим, і в цьому випадку такі моменти можна просто пропустити.

Читати далі →

Google запустила бета-версію Cloud Spanner — СУБД покоління NewSQL



Google відкрила для всіх бета-версію сервісу Cloud Spanner, глобально розподіленої высокомасштабируемой мультиверсионной NewSQL БД з підтримкою розподілених транзакцій.

Кілька років Google використовувала цей сервіс виключно для внутрішніх потреб. На ньому працюють ключові системи Google, в тому числі AdWords і Google Play. Spanner — еволюційний розвиток NoSQL-попередника Google Bigtable. Сам же c Spanner відносять до сімейства NewSQL-рішень, тобто воно поєднує в собі переваги реляційних і нереляційних СУБД. Це ACID-транзакції і синтаксис SQL традиційних СУБД без шкоди для горизонтального масштабування і високої доступності, властивих NoSQL.

Виходячи з досвіду роботи системи всередині компанії, Google пропонує клієнтам аптайм 99,9999% (шість дев'яток, тобто максимум 31,5 секунди простою в рік), клієнтські бібліотеки з підтримкою Java, Go, Python, Node.js та ін

Читати далі →